Job description

This multi-site professional services firm have created a new role for an experienced IT Training Lead, to help enhance their training capabilities. You will provide strategic direction and operational leadership to the training team, whilst still having an active involvement in the delivery of training and creating of training material.

As an IT Training Lead, you will support a business that is constantly evolving and looking for new ways to learn. Your role will work closely with Project and Change Managers to ensure successful technology adoption by thousands of staff and stakeholders.

The role has a hybrid working set up and requires 2 days per week in central Nottingham., Manage and implement the IT Training Strategy. Lead a team of IT Trainers, fostering a collaborative culture and developing the capabilities of team members Design and deliver training material in various different formats Monitor and assess staff knowledge absorption and the effectiveness of training Design and deliver training feedback evaluations for all training formats Drive the businesses entire training capability in conjunction with business objectives and technology roadmap Provide effective post implementation user support for system change projects, Administer training courses, Core skills & experience for this role

Requirements

3+ years' experience in a similar IT Training role Proven leadership / managerial experience Experience working within the Legal sector is highly desirable, with an understanding of case management, financial processes etc Experience providing training on complex systems. Stakeholder Management and Change Management skills Understanding of key training tools and technology to design and deliver training Experience of digital learning platforms and learning management systems
